Jul 28, 2023 · In Captivity. In contrast, when provided with proper care in captivity, the lifespan of leopard geckos increases significantly. Many live to be around 15 to 20 years old, with some even reaching the ripe old age of 25 years or more. It’s fascinating to note that the longest-lived leopard gecko on record made it to an astounding 32 years ... By looking at the lizards’ broader heads and neck area, you will note this. Typically, a female Leo averages 7-8 inches in length compared to the male’s 8-11 inches. A male leopard gecko averages 60-80 grams in body weight, while females average 50-70 grams. The male species tend to be more prominent in stature for the following reasons;

A female leopard gecko used for breeding purposes has a life expectancy between 6-10 years. A non-breeding female leo will live between 10-15 years with proper husbandry. Conclusion. Orange-spotted Day ...Be sure to provide multiple hides, both a dry hide and a humid hide, whether it's a rock cave or half log to sleep in the tank. Temperatures should be around 90 degrees Fahrenheit on the hot end and in the high 70s to low 80s on the cool side of the tank. Humidity should be between 40-60% on average for this species.Albino Leopard Gecko Life Expectancy. WILD HISTORY:Instagram:https://instagram. porcelain sink repairunited vacation packagesaudible for student discountfood in columbia md Juvenile geckos have a faster metabolism, so they should be fed daily. Typically, 4-8 appropriately-sized insects per feeding session work well. For adult geckos, feeding them 3-4 times a week is sufficient. At each feeding, offer around 6-10 insects, depending on their size. Leopard gecko. The leopard gecko or common leopard gecko ( Eublepharis macularius) is a ground-dwelling gecko native to the rocky dry grassland and desert regions of Afghanistan, Iran, Pakistan, India, and Nepal.
